Web制作 CSS教程
隨著現(xiàn)代 Web 開發(fā)的不斷演變和發(fā)展,CSS 已經(jīng)成為了 Web 開發(fā)中不可或缺的一部分。掌握 CSS 技能對于 Web 開發(fā)人員來說非常重要,因?yàn)樗梢允?Web 頁面更加美觀、易于閱讀和使用。在本文中,我們將介紹 CSS 的基礎(chǔ)知識以及如何使用 CSS 來創(chuàng)建不同類型的 Web 頁面。
一、CSS 基礎(chǔ)知識
1. CSS 類型
CSS 可以分為以下三種類型:
- 樣式表(Stylesheet):用于定義 CSS 樣式的文本文件。
- 選擇器(CSS Rule):用于選擇 HTML 元素或其子元素的屬性的指令。
- 布局(Layout):用于創(chuàng)建網(wǎng)頁布局的指令。
2. CSS 屬性
CSS 屬性用于定義 HTML 元素的樣式。它們可以是基本屬性(如顏色、字體、大小等)或選擇器屬性(如邊框、背景色、字體顏色等)。以下是一些常見的 CSS 屬性:
- 顏色(Color):用于設(shè)置元素的字體和背景顏色。
- 字體(Font):用于設(shè)置元素的字體大小、樣式和顏色。
- 大小(SIZE):用于設(shè)置元素的字體大小。
- 斜體(斜體):用于設(shè)置元素的字體斜體。
- 下劃線(Underline):用于設(shè)置元素的下劃線。
- 背景色(Background):用于設(shè)置元素的背景顏色。
- 邊框(邊框和底紋):用于設(shè)置元素的邊框和底紋。
- 內(nèi)邊距(Inner 邊的距離):用于設(shè)置元素的內(nèi)邊距。
- 外邊距(Outer 邊的距離):用于設(shè)置元素的外邊距。
3. CSS 選擇器
CSS 選擇器用于選擇 HTML 元素或其子元素的屬性。它們可以是基本選擇器(如 #id 選擇器)或類選擇器(如 .class 選擇器)。以下是一些常見的 CSS 選擇器:
- ID 選擇器(#id 選擇器):用于選擇具有 ID 屬性的 HTML 元素。
- 類選擇器(.class 選擇器):用于選擇具有 .class 屬性的 HTML 元素。
- 屬性選擇器(:屬性名):用于選擇具有指定屬性的 HTML 元素。
- 偽類選擇器(偽類選擇器):用于創(chuàng)建不同類型的 HTML 元素。
二、CSS 布局
CSS 布局是指使用 CSS 來創(chuàng)建網(wǎng)頁布局的方法。它可以使網(wǎng)頁更加美觀和易于使用。以下是一些常見的 CSS 布局方法:
1. 層疊布局(Stacking Layout):將多個(gè) HTML 元素組合在一起,形成復(fù)雜的布局。
2. 分離布局(Split Layout):將 HTML 元素分為不同的區(qū)域,并將它們組合在一起。
3. 表格布局(表格布局):使用 CSS 創(chuàng)建表格并使其具有清晰的布局。
4. 響應(yīng)式布局(Responsive layout):適應(yīng)不同屏幕大小和分辨率的網(wǎng)頁布局。
要掌握 CSS 布局技能,建議實(shí)踐以下練習(xí):
1. 創(chuàng)建一個(gè)簡單的網(wǎng)頁,包括一個(gè)表格和一個(gè)單頁。
2. 使用分離布局創(chuàng)建一個(gè)具有表格的網(wǎng)頁。
3. 使用層疊布局創(chuàng)建一個(gè)具有表格和段落的網(wǎng)頁。
4. 使用表格布局創(chuàng)建一個(gè)具有表格和段落的網(wǎng)頁。
通過實(shí)踐,可以更好地理解 CSS 布局原理,并掌握如何使用 CSS 來創(chuàng)建不同類型的 Web 頁面。